JSI Tip 7792. When Windows XP resumes from hibernation, you receive a 0x000000A5 BSOD?

You will experience a 0x000000A5 stop if you add RAM while the computer is hibernating.

NOTE: You must always shutdown prior to changing RAM.

If this problem persists after restarting your computer, use the Recovery Console to delete the Hiberfil.sys file.

NOTE: The System event log will contain an error similar to:

Date: <Date>
Source: System
Time: <Time>
Category: (102)
Type: Error
Event ID: 1003
User: N/A 
Computer: <ComputerName>
Description: Error code 000000A5, parameter1 00000011, parameter2 00000006, parameter3 00000000, parameter4 00000000.
